Тёмный
No video :(

Learn Azure Functions Python V2 (Local Setup and Examples) 

Data Engineering With Nick
Подписаться 1,8 тыс.
Просмотров 17 тыс.
50% 1

This video goes over how to setup and work with Azure Functions Python V2 locally. Includes HTTP and storage example functions.
Links:
-Part 2 RU-vid Video (Deploy, Configure and Use in Azure): • Learn Azure Functions ...
-Install Azure Functions Core Tools: learn.microsof...
-Install Azurite (local storage emulator): learn.microsof...
-Install Azure Storage Explorer: azure.microsof...
-DataEngineeringWithNick Azure Functions code repo: github.com/Dat...

Опубликовано:

 

29 авг 2024

Поделиться:

Ссылка:

Скачать:

Готовим ссылку...

Добавить в:

Мой плейлист
Посмотреть позже
Комментарии : 59   
@joemx149
@joemx149 7 месяцев назад
What a nice tutorial! Excellent. All one have to know. Impatiently waiting for part 2: deployment.
@dataengineeringwithnick7532
@dataengineeringwithnick7532 2 месяца назад
Thanks so much! Just released part 2 here: ru-vid.com/video/%D0%B2%D0%B8%D0%B4%D0%B5%D0%BE-_349bwtFkE8.html
@danielotto8386
@danielotto8386 4 месяца назад
This is the best intro video to Azure functions with Python v2 by far! Highly encourage you to make part 2 :)
@dataengineeringwithnick7532
@dataengineeringwithnick7532 2 месяца назад
Thank you! I just finished and released part 2: ru-vid.com/video/%D0%B2%D0%B8%D0%B4%D0%B5%D0%BE-_349bwtFkE8.html
@mantrax314
@mantrax314 2 месяца назад
One of the BEST tutorials. I understand so much better from here than documentation.
@MT-gw4vm
@MT-gw4vm 2 месяца назад
Thank you for this video! Everything is so clearly explained. I had no idea what local development looked like for azure functions, so this video was quite eye opening.
@jefwesb
@jefwesb 5 месяцев назад
Great video Nick, looking forward to part 2.
@dataengineeringwithnick7532
@dataengineeringwithnick7532 2 месяца назад
Thank you! Just released part 2 here: ru-vid.com/video/%D0%B2%D0%B8%D0%B4%D0%B5%D0%BE-_349bwtFkE8.html
@cristianvargasestay1086
@cristianvargasestay1086 6 месяцев назад
I had this video open, along with another 20 tabs on Brave, and i learnt it the hard way.... i wished i'd started with this video. It was very clear, you explained the decorators, another kind of triggers... very helpful
@hyakushiki23
@hyakushiki23 7 месяцев назад
Dude you made an awesome video. Super helpful! I'm with the pack also waiting for part 2
@dataengineeringwithnick7532
@dataengineeringwithnick7532 2 месяца назад
Appreciate it! Just released part 2 here: ru-vid.com/video/%D0%B2%D0%B8%D0%B4%D0%B5%D0%BE-_349bwtFkE8.html
@SomethingRandomChannel
@SomethingRandomChannel 6 месяцев назад
That was brilliant man, please release the next one! ❤❤
@dataengineeringwithnick7532
@dataengineeringwithnick7532 2 месяца назад
Thank you! Just released the part 2 video here: ru-vid.com/video/%D0%B2%D0%B8%D0%B4%D0%B5%D0%BE-_349bwtFkE8.html
@priyankagorkhe2870
@priyankagorkhe2870 6 месяцев назад
Thanks a million! I was searching for this kind of teaching from last 2 weeks! Life saving for me😊
@Mars6555
@Mars6555 4 часа назад
Buddy, It's very useful. Thank you.
@user-uf6fu2pv2c
@user-uf6fu2pv2c 3 месяца назад
Here's the revised message: Nick, awesome video 🤩!! Your passion and expertise make complex things easy to understand, just like Azure Functions simplify cloud computing . Thanks a million for sharing your knowledge and inspiring others 👏💻"
@dataengineeringwithnick7532
@dataengineeringwithnick7532 2 месяца назад
Thank you so much!
@trushankdesai7633
@trushankdesai7633 Месяц назад
Saved a day, thank you for teaching this, its has wide amount applications
@MrAbhishekparida
@MrAbhishekparida 6 месяцев назад
pls start a course in functions ... .Loved it . liked and subscribed
@tjw590
@tjw590 Месяц назад
Great video, very helpful! Thank you
@shreyaroraa2234
@shreyaroraa2234 8 месяцев назад
Good video Nick. Will be waiting for part2 deployment
@dataengineeringwithnick7532
@dataengineeringwithnick7532 2 месяца назад
Thanks! Just released part 2 here: ru-vid.com/video/%D0%B2%D0%B8%D0%B4%D0%B5%D0%BE-_349bwtFkE8.html
@torsteinlunde3931
@torsteinlunde3931 5 месяцев назад
This is very good and clear explaining!
@bassboy8211
@bassboy8211 3 месяца назад
Loved this video, would love to see the part 2
@dataengineeringwithnick7532
@dataengineeringwithnick7532 2 месяца назад
Thank you! Just released the part 2 video: ru-vid.com/video/%D0%B2%D0%B8%D0%B4%D0%B5%D0%BE-_349bwtFkE8.html
@lowellzima182
@lowellzima182 6 месяцев назад
Excellent video thanks ! I am at the deploy process, where I need this Azure Functions API for a Static Web App Ressource, and my function doesn't appear on my panel in azure portal, whereas I put them in blueprints and called it like you. On local setup, it works like a charm, but deployement doesn't work as expected. Do you have this video on the deployement somewhere ? I didn't find it on your channel. Anyway, thanks for the clarity, nice content you have there ! EDIT : I was able to make it work :)
@dataengineeringwithnick7532
@dataengineeringwithnick7532 2 месяца назад
Thanks! Yes, just released the part 2 video: ru-vid.com/video/%D0%B2%D0%B8%D0%B4%D0%B5%D0%BE-_349bwtFkE8.html
@omarcruz6326
@omarcruz6326 6 месяцев назад
Hi Nick ! I wanted to see that I have watched a couple of videos about this topic and for sure I can say that the material that you are sharing here has a very very good quality. Great Job !!! I definitively: Like & Subscribe ! 👌 I will also recommend your channel to family and friends !
@emrahe468
@emrahe468 6 месяцев назад
you should give some online courses. this was the most understandable & clear azure video i have seen, as a beginner
@emrahe468
@emrahe468 6 месяцев назад
fyi, there is huge lack on Udemy about the Azure Functions v2 Python. almost all of the courses are outdated or v1 or lack of coverage. if you can act quick, you can make a really nice start with an ~4h course
@badoiuecristian
@badoiuecristian 2 месяца назад
Thank you, great tutorial to get started with the new model
@muftkuseng5924
@muftkuseng5924 5 месяцев назад
This video was so helpful! When do you plan for part 2? You are so clear in your instructions!
@dataengineeringwithnick7532
@dataengineeringwithnick7532 2 месяца назад
Thanks! I just finished and released part 2: ru-vid.com/video/%D0%B2%D0%B8%D0%B4%D0%B5%D0%BE-_349bwtFkE8.html
@Its_ur_amy
@Its_ur_amy 6 месяцев назад
Thanks a lot for awesome setup walkthrough
@TheWongAndOnly910
@TheWongAndOnly910 2 месяца назад
Great tutorial.
@Paul_Klimb
@Paul_Klimb 7 месяцев назад
Wow! this is excellent, thank you so much! What I did was I setup ADF with event grid to trigger an Azure Function. This is all working fine. What I am working on now is the unit testing for that Azure Function. Anyway, if you have time, would you be able to go through the CI process with Unit Testing for an azure function?
@johnaweiss
@johnaweiss 4 месяца назад
8:37 With `IsEncrypted` = true, the following does nothing -- no new setting is added: `func settings add "myConn" "1234"` Edit: I was wrong, this is s refresh issue on the VS code interface.
@mandeeplamba
@mandeeplamba 4 месяца назад
Hi, great intro, do you have videos or can make few for Durable Function and Orchestrations.
@badoiucristian4780
@badoiucristian4780 2 месяца назад
for linux debian to activate venv the command is source './.venv/bin/activate' now the path my differ depending on the version of the venv, i don't have scripts
@nostalgia18rishi
@nostalgia18rishi 5 месяцев назад
Great content. around 13:09 when I run the test_function I get this error - No job functions found. Try making your job classes and methods public. If you're using binding extensions (e.g. Azure Storage, ServiceBus, Timers, etc.) make sure you've called the registration method for the extension(s) in your startup code (e.g. builder.AddAzureStorage(), builder.AddServiceBus(), builder.AddTimers(), etc.). None of the stack overflow solutions help. Could you help?
@dataengineeringwithnick7532
@dataengineeringwithnick7532 5 месяцев назад
Hi @nostalgia18rishi. It's because you have a syntax error either in the additional_functions.py file or the main function_app.py file. In the additional_functions.py file, make sure it matches exactly to mine: github.com/DataEngineeringWithNick/AzureFunctionsPythonV2/tree/main/MyFunctionProject. Then in the function_app.py file, make sure you register the additional function (from additional_functions import bp) app = func.FunctionApp() app.register_blueprint(bp). Hope this helps.
@tadastadux
@tadastadux 2 месяца назад
thank you. great video. how to pass people.csv as paramater?
@Apagador69
@Apagador69 4 месяца назад
You DO know IDE does NOT stand for Interactive Development Environment, right ?
@pavankumarchahar
@pavankumarchahar 3 месяца назад
how to define output binding in V2 Programming model for example I want to write a file to another blob container or postgres SQL , Database after perform Transformation steps to source (input files).
@dataengineeringwithnick7532
@dataengineeringwithnick7532 2 месяца назад
Here's the doc for setting up a blob output binding: learn.microsoft.com/en-us/azure/azure-functions/functions-bindings-storage-blob-output?tabs=python-v2%2Cisolated-process%2Cnodejs-v4&pivots=programming-language-python. It's a similar initial setup like in the video except you'd use an @app.blob_output (and additional code from the doc link). when defining it. The code block from the documentation should help with how to define it.
@karthikeyanrajendran3194
@karthikeyanrajendran3194 3 месяца назад
I am getting an error No module found name azure , in import azure.functions as func. Can you let me know how to fix this
@dataengineeringwithnick7532
@dataengineeringwithnick7532 2 месяца назад
Did you install the azure-functions Python library in your virtual environment? If not, add azure-functions to your requirements.txt file and then in the command line run pip install -r requirements.txt. When importing the module in the function_app.py file, also make sure there's no space. Should be import azure.functions as func
@karthikeyanrajendran3194
@karthikeyanrajendran3194 2 месяца назад
@@dataengineeringwithnick7532 Yeah I did it and now I am getting an ODBC error. I am calling a SQL stored procedure and it was working fine until last week. All of a sudden I am getting Login failed for the user error. I was able to manually login to the server with same user. Any idea what could be the reason.
@abduljaweed8131
@abduljaweed8131 6 месяцев назад
Hi bro I have one scenario like i have a documents in cosmosdb for nosql and i want to create a pipeline to triggered it if certain value is updated in cosmosdb document like age=21then trigger the event and then perform some transformation using python and then send that changes to new cosmosdb container If you make one video on that scenario that could be great helpful
@cboyda
@cboyda 7 месяцев назад
Great content, but please stop closing the expanded explorers along with typing CLS, it makes it impossible to read the actual code output unless the video is constantly paused :(
@dataengineeringwithnick7532
@dataengineeringwithnick7532 7 месяцев назад
Great feedback. Will be aware of that for future videos. Thanks!
@2762raju
@2762raju 7 месяцев назад
I have one doubt
@johnaweiss
@johnaweiss 4 месяца назад
i don't have setuptools
@johnaweiss
@johnaweiss 4 месяца назад
i added setuptools to requirements.txt, close/saved it, and i got this: > pip install -r . equirements.txt Requirement already satisfied: azure-functions in c:\users\johny\onedrive\documents\coding\python\myfxproj\.venv\lib\site-packages (from -r . equirements.txt (line 5)) (1.19.0) Collecting setuptools (from -r . equirements.txt (line 6)) Downloading setuptools-69.5.0-py3-none-any.whl.metadata (6.2 kB) Downloading setuptools-69.5.0-py3-none-any.whl (893 kB) ━━━━━━━━━━━━━━━━━━━━━ 893.7/893.7 kB 1.2 MB/s eta 0:00:00 Installing collected packages: setuptools Successfully installed setuptools-69.5.0
Далее